Sixty-Six

"Mother!" I screamed, tears filling my eyes as I took in her state.

"There you are, Princess. We've been looking all over for you. " the king smirked at me, walking towards my mother.

"What did you do to her? Leave her alone!" I screamed and he just laughed, tugging her hair backwards.

"You mean this bitch? I wouldn't be hurting her if it wasn't for you now would I?"

Realisation dawned over me. The only reason they couldn't find her was because she hid well, but now I had brought them right to her footstep.

"Leave her alone. I'm here now. I'll go with you!"

The king let out a dark chuckle as he sneered at her. "Miss me baby?"

She gave a snarl. "I would never forgive you for destroying our family. You destroyed everything you touch!"

His eyes darkened, and his hand rose to strike her, the movement causing her head to snap back.

"Stop hurting her!" I screamed but I was ignored. My eye went to Xander's who were void of emotion as he stared at his mother and disgust filled me.
